#c7dd66 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c7dd66 is composed of 78% red, 86.7%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10% cyan, 0% magenta, 53.8%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 71.1 degrees, a saturation of 63.6% and a lightness of 63.3%. #c7dd66 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ffcc with #8fbb00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

#c7dd66 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c7dd66 has RGB values of R:199, G:221, B:102 and CMYK values of C:0.1, M:0, Y:0.54,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 13098342.

Hex triplet c7dd66 #c7dd66
RGB Decimal 199, 221, 102 rgb(199,221,102)
RGB Percent 78, 86.7, 40 rgb(78%,86.7%,40%)
CMYK 10, 0, 54, 13
HSL 71.1°, 63.6, 63.3 hsl(71.1,63.6%,63.3%)
HSV (or HSB) 71.1°, 53.8, 86.7
Web Safe cccc66 #cccc66
CIE-LAB 84.388, -24.274, 55.103
XYZ 51.807, 64.814, 22.351
xyY 0.373, 0.466, 64.814
CIE-LCH 84.388, 60.212, 113.774
CIE-LUV 84.388, -8.676, 72.735
Hunter-Lab 80.507, -26.021, 39.895
Binary 11000111, 11011101, 01100110

Shades and Tints of #c7dd66

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060702 is the darkest color, while #fcfdf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c7dd66

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a3a3a0 is the less saturated color, while #d9fa49 is the most saturated one.
